如何优化网站的加载速度和性能?

逆风 技术分享评论223字数 685阅读模式

优化网站的加载速度和性能是一个多方面的过程,涉及到从服务器配置到前端设计的多个方面。以下是一些关键点,可以帮助提高网站的加载速度和性能:

优化图片和媒体文件:

压缩图片和视频文件,以减少它们的大小。
使用适当的文件格式,例如使用WebP格式的图片,因为它通常比PNG或JPEG格式更小。
实施懒加载,即仅在用户滚动到页面的某个部分时才加载图片。
使用内容分发网络(CDN):

CDN可以将内容缓存到全球多个位置的服务器上,从而减少数据传输时间。
优化代码和减少HTTP请求:

压缩CSS、JavaScript和HTML文件。
合并CSS和JavaScript文件,减少服务器的HTTP请求。
移除未使用的代码和库。
浏览器缓存利用:

通过设置适当的缓存策略,可以使返回访问者更快地加载页面。
服务器和托管优化:

使用高性能的服务器和数据库。
如果可能,使用专用或虚拟专用服务器而不是共享托管。
使用异步加载:

异步加载CSS和JavaScript文件,以防止它们阻塞页面的其它部分的加载。
优化数据库查询:

优化后端数据库查询,确保数据检索是高效的。
响应式设计:

确保网站对于不同设备和屏幕尺寸是优化的。
利用Web Performance API:

使用Web Performance API来监控和分析网站性能。
定期进行性能测试:

定期使用工具如Google PageSpeed Insights, Lighthouse, GTmetrix等来检测网站性能,并根据其建议进行优化。
通过实施这些策略,可以显著提高网站的加载速度和整体性能。记住,网站性能优化是一个持续的过程,随着技术的发展和网站内容的变化,需要定期进行检查和调整。

转载请保留原文链接
逆风
  • 本文由 发表于 2024年2月16日 11:32:20
  • 转载请务必保留本文链接:https://blog.smallxu.com/post/777/
评论  0  访客  0
匿名

发表评论

匿名网友

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: